Hallo,
ich plane ein Suchmaschinenscript. Die ersten zwei Dateien sind fertig. Ich möchte es ohne MySQL haben. Jede Homepage wird mit titel, url und beschreibung so eingetragen:
titel|beschreibung|url
Hier die registrieren.php:
[PHP]<?php
if ($titel == "")
{
echo "Bitte geben Sie einen Titel ein";
}
if ($beschreibung == "")
{
echo "Bitte geben Sie eine Beschreibung ein";
}
if ($url == "")
{
echo "Bitte geben Sie eine URL ein";
}
echo "Ok weiter gehts...";
echo " ";
echo "Weiter";
if(isset($register))
{
$code("$titel|$beschreibung|$url");
$fp = fopen("seiten.txt","a") or die("Datei konnte nicht in diesem Modus geöffnet werden");
fputs($fp,$code) or die("Etwas lief schief. Die Homepage konnte nicht eingetragen werden");
fclose($fp) or die("Datei konnte nicht geschlossen werden");
}
else {
?>
body {
font-family : Arial, Verdana, Helvetica, sans-serif;
font-size : 12px;
color : #000000;
line-height : 16px;
}
td {
font-family : Arial, Verdana, Helvetica, sans-serif;
font-size : 12px;
color : #000000;
line-height : 16px;
}
a:link {
color : #000000;
text-decoration : underline;
}
a:visited {
color : #000000;
text-decoration : underline;
}
a:hover {
color : #000000;
text-decoration : none;
}
a:active {
color : #000000;
text-decoration : underline;
}
Seite eintragen/Registireren
Seite eintragen
Titel
Beschreibung
URL
Alle Felder müssen ausgefüllt werden.
<?php
}
?>[/PHP]
Jetzt möchte ich aber suchen. Ich öffne die Datei zum lesen:
$fp = fopen(„seiten.txt“,„r“);
Ich glaube anschließend muss auch was mit explode(„|“); kommen.
da muss ich XraYSoLo zustimmen,
wenn du wirklich eine gute Suchmaschine hast dann musst du mysql nehmen, denn da kannst du Sortiert ausgeben, genau Suchen usw…
Jo aber dann müstet ihr mir sehr stark unter die arme greifen da ich nich mysql profi bin. Die suchmaschine von http://www.cj-design.com/ ist auch in einer txt/dat Datei und läuft auch klasse. Aber naja mysql dann helft mir mal